WordPress Core Flaw Allows Unauthenticated Code Execution

A critical vulnerability in WordPress core allows un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ary code on affected websites. The flaw, discovered by Adam Kues of Searchlight Cyber, impacted all sites running versions 6.9 and 7.0. WordPress has since released patches 6.9.5 and 7.0.2, and has enabled forced updates to protect all sites.
